THERE ARE ALSO THE USUAL SOCIAL CLASSES THAT ARE FOUND IN INDUSTRIAL SOCIETY. ITALY HAS A HIGH UNEMPLOYMENT RATE, AND DIFFERENCES BETWEEN RICH AND POOR ARE NOTICEABLE. NEW IMMIGRANTS STAND OUT SINCE THEY COME FROM POORER COUNTRIES. THE GOVERNMENT HAS HAD A VAST SOCIAL WELFARE NETWORK THAT HAS BEEN CUT IN RECENT YEARS TO FIT THE REQUIREMENTS OF THE EUROPEAN UNION. THESE BUDGET CUTS HAVE FALLEN ON THE POORER STRATA OF SOCIETY.
Almost 40% of the Italian territory is mountainous,[1] with the Alps as the northern boundary and the Apennine Mountains forming the backbone of the peninsula and extending for 1,350 km (840 mi)
